My argument is that it's not worth buying an N64 just for Goldeneye, because we all have PCs and there are excellent late 90s FPSs on the PC. Goldeneye doesn't particularly stand out.
Robotron 64 on the other hand is a pretty unique experience, there aren't that many 3d multidirectional shooters. Cannon Spike is the only other one that comes to mind. To me, it's uniqueness and excellent game play make this a must own. It's worth buying an N64 for this game alone.
Of course Goldeneye is still one of the best games on the system, and if you own an N64 you should have it. I just think Robotron 64 doesn't get enough recognition.
